Courthouse
The , located on the 400 block of Main Street in , , is the center of government of . The courthouse was built in 1911 after Roswell's citizens learned that New Mexico would become a state the next year. is situated 2 miles east of J. Kenneth Smith Bird Sanctuary and Nature Center.
